Boating Know How
Posted in: Boating
Learning to boat isn’t just getting the oars and rowing. This is because some of the vessels are powered using fuel and engines making it go faster and farther than before.
People who want to start from scratch and learn everything about sailing should start with a sail boat. These vessels have been used for many years and provide the basics for modern navigation.
You can first go to the dock and sign up with someone offering lessons. There will be small and big boats in the harbor so you should try these one at a time to learn the similarities and differences of being on board.
It will be a good idea to take down notes in class to be able to remember what to do when it is time to change direction or to raise the sail.
Some of the people on board are veteran sailors. The seafarer shouldn’t be afraid to ask questions to learn other things which may not be taught in the classroom which also serves as preparation when it is time to be in that position.
Aside from the lectures, it is also advisable to watch instructional videos, read magazines and books and surf the web for sailing information. Things that are hard to understand should be raised in class for further explanation.
The most important thing to watch out for aside from the various positions on the boat is the weather. There are instruments that are used to determine this and knowing this will surely help in assessing its influence on the actions of the crew and the boat.
Being in the water on a sail boat or a power boat entails teamwork. Being observant of the functions of those on board can give a clearer picture of how everything functions.
The best test for the students is when the instructor decides to let the crew enter a real race course. The port or harbor where ships are docked usually have them three to four times a year especially during good weather.
After graduation, the boating enthusiast can apply for a boating license. After passing the exam, you will be able to set sail and bring other passengers on board.
Boats are expensive toys. You don't have to buy one since there are some owners who rent these vessels for a small fee so that others may also enjoy the open sea.
